    To be fair, these Insignia's at £11/12k are the very base 1.8 models that have a list price of £15999, so take into account a dealers discount and also the FDA offered, which you can guarantee is being included to get this low price, and it's not a case of the Insignia having bad depreciation.

    If the same deal was done on an SRi 2.0 CDTi 160 with a list price of £21K, it would be in the region of £16800. But it does not sound as good a deal as the price is still circa £17k.

    I rang a certian dealer today that is advertising Insignia's at £12250 on the road, I said I was interested in paying cash and not having any finance, and the dealer said he could not give me the car at £12250 but would let me have it at just over £14K.

    The reason? By paying cash he could not offer the FDA (Finance deposit allowance)

    So all these low price's are pretty false unless your having finance. Personally I think this is the wrong way of doing things and Vauxhall should put a stop to it.
